Understanding Product Categories and Core Technical Specifications
The market for freestanding household air fragrance machines encompasses a diverse range of devices designed to disperse essential oils or synthetic fragrances into residential and commercial environments. When sourcing these units, buyers must first distinguish between the various technical configurations available, as specifications vary significantly even within the same product category. Based on current market observations, these devices generally fall into two primary power and capacity tiers. One segment features compact units with a 200ml water tank capacity, often powered by a 4-watt system operating at 12 volts. These models are frequently constructed with metal components and are designed for tabletop or portable placement, making them ideal for smaller rooms or specific hotel room setups.
In contrast, a second segment includes larger capacity units, such as those with 800ml water tanks or 400ml oil bottles, which are engineered for broader coverage. These higher-capacity models often operate at 8 to 12 watts and may utilize PP (polypropylene) materials for durability. The physical dimensions of these machines also vary, with observed standard sizes ranging from approximately 15.5x7.5x21cm to larger footprints like 16x16x39cm. A critical technical distinction lies in the installation method; while some units are designed strictly for lay-flat placement, others support wall-mounted installation, offering greater flexibility for interior design integration. Buyers must verify the specific operating voltage, as the supply chain shows options for DC12V systems, which are common for low-voltage safety in home environments, alongside other voltage configurations.
Operational Capabilities and Control Mechanisms
Modern air fragrance machines are defined by their operational sophistication, particularly regarding timing functions and control methods. A standard feature across many models is the support for timing functions, allowing users to program specific intervals for fragrance dispersion. This capability is essential for energy efficiency and preventing over-saturation of a room. The control mechanisms have evolved from simple machine controls to include digital interfaces and mobile application connectivity. This shift enables remote management, where users can adjust spray volume, timing, and concentration levels via a smartphone.
The spray volume itself is a critical performance metric. Data indicates that spray output can be adjusted based on essential oil concentration, with some units calibrated to deliver specific fuel consumption rates, such as 2ml per hour. Noise levels are another vital operational parameter; observed units typically operate within a range of 30db to 40db, ensuring that the fragrance machine does not become a source of disturbance in quiet environments like bedrooms or hotel guest rooms. The operating language support for digital interfaces is also a consideration, with many units supporting multiple languages including English, German, French, Dutch, and Spanish, which is particularly relevant for international hotel chains or export markets.
Application Scenarios and Environmental Suitability
The application scope for these freestanding units is broad, spanning both residential and commercial sectors. The primary usage categories identified are for home and hotel environments. In a residential setting, the compact 200ml models are well-suited for personal spaces, while larger units may be deployed in living areas. For the hospitality industry, the ability to install units on walls or lay them flat allows for versatile integration into room design schemes. The area coverage is another key factor; larger capacity units are often rated for environments ranging from 500 to 1000 cubic meters, making them suitable for large suites or public areas within a hotel.
The choice of material also influences suitability. Metal construction offers a premium aesthetic often desired in high-end hotels, whereas PP (polypropylene) materials provide a lightweight, durable option that is resistant to corrosion from essential oils. The color options, typically available in black or white, allow buyers to match the device to existing interior decor. Furthermore, the customization availability for these products suggests that buyers can request specific branding or functional adjustments to meet unique application requirements, ensuring the device aligns with the specific brand identity of a hotel chain or residential developer.

Comparative Analysis of Key Product Attributes
To facilitate decision-making, the following table summarizes the key technical attributes observed in the current market for freestanding household air fragrance machines. This comparison highlights the variance in specifications that buyers must navigate when selecting the right product for their specific needs.
| Attribute | Compact/Tabletop Model | Large/Capacity Model |
|---|---|---|
| Water Tank Capacity | 200ml | 800ml / 180ml |
| Power Consumption | 4W | 8W - 12W |
| Operating Voltage | 12V / DC12V | DC12V / 12V/1A |
| Material | Metal | PP (Polypropylene) |
| Control Method | Machine Control | Digital Control / Mobile APP |
| Noise Level | 30db | 40db |
| Installation | Lay Flat | Lay Flat / Wall |
| Product Weight | 0.8kg | 0.85kg - 0.9kg |
| Spray Volume | Adjustable Concentration | 2ml/Hr Fuel Consumption |
| Standard Size | 15.5x7.5x21cm | 16x16x39cm |
This comparison underscores the importance of aligning product specifications with the intended application. For instance, a hotel requiring wall-mounted units for large suites would prioritize the large capacity model with wall installation support, while a boutique hotel focusing on room-specific ambiance might opt for the compact, metal-finished tabletop units.
